TEAS Reduces Remifentanil Consumption
Transcutaneous electrical acupoint stimulation (TEAS) has been shown to decrease the need of opioids including remifentanil during anaesthesia. However, it is not clear whether combination of two or more acupoints could induce stronger analgesia. Moreover, evidence for the long-term effect of TEAS has been limited. The present study was to compare the short-term and long-term effect on pain of dual-acupoint and single-acupoint TEAS.

Inclusion criteria
- 18 to 65 yrs
- body mass index (BMI) of 18 to 30 kg/m2
- elective radical mastectomy under general anaesthesia
Exclusion criteria
- contradictions to TEAS
- difficulties in communication
- histories of general anaesthesia
- drug or alcohol abuse or addiction
- cardiac dysfunction or severe hypertension
- confirmed hepatic dysfunction and renal impairment
- the participants recruited into other clinical trials during last three months
